Frequently Asked Questions about Arcadia
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Arcadia area of Scottsdale, AZ?
As of today, August 07, 2026, there are currently 118 available Arcadia apartments priced from $950 to $29,500, with an average monthly rent of $2,222.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Arcadia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Arcadia ranges from $950 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,860.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Arcadia c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Arcadia range from $1,250 to $4,256.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,850.
